Description

This book offers historical and contemporary international analysis of fraud and corruption in sport, including a diverse range of cases from the sporting world including football, cricket, horse racing and boxing.

Author Biography:

Graham Brooks is a Senior Lecturer in Criminology at the University of Portsmouth, UK. His research interests focus on fraud and corruption.   Azeem Aleem is Principal Lecturer in Risk and Security at the University of Portsmouth, UK.   Mark Button is Reader in Criminology at the University of Portsmouth, UK. He specialises in security and counter fraud.
